The Deye SUN-M200G4-EU-Q0 is a modern 2000W microinverter with four independent MPPT trackers, IP67 protection, and integrated power limitation to 800W for the German market. It is optimized for four solar modules and significantly increases energy yield even with partial shading. With Wi-Fi monitoring, high efficiency, and long lifespan, it is particularly suitable for balcony power plants and small PV systems in private households.

How does the 4-module control work with the Deye system?
Each of the four MPPT trackers operates independently and optimizes the performance of each individual module. This prevents a weaker or shaded module from affecting the overall performance. The intelligent control dynamically adjusts the energy output and ensures maximum efficiency. Why are the G4 upgrades important in the Deye SUN-M200G4-EU-Q0?
The G4 generation brings improved cooling, more stable communication, and an integrated safety relay. These technical improvements increase lifespan and reduce maintenance. At the same time, system stability is improved even at high temperatures. DRBO Greenenergy rates this generation as particularly reliable for long-term balcony photovoltaic projects.
How is the Deye SUN-M200G4-EU-Q0 installed?
Installation follows the plug-and-play principle. Four solar modules are connected via MC4 connectors, while the inverter is integrated into the household grid via a standard connection. The IP67 certification allows for safe outdoor installation. An app supports easy commissioning and monitoring. What advantages does the Deye offer for the 800W regulation?
The integrated relay automatically reduces the output power to 800W, thus meeting legal requirements. This eliminates the need for additional limiting hardware. At the same time, full module power is maintained in the background, allowing peak yields to be efficiently utilized.
